Excel引用前表格数据库技巧揭秘,如何快速实现数据关联?
在 Excel 中引用前表格数据库,可以通过1、使用“引用单元格”功能,2、利用“命名范围”,3、借助 Power Query 工具,4、采用 VLOOKUP 或 INDEX/MATCH 公式等方式实现。其中,Power Query 工具尤其适合于将外部表格作为数据库数据源进行动态提取和整合。以 Power Query 为例,它支持直接连接 Excel 文件、数据库甚至网页数据,并可自动同步更新数据内容,为多表引用和分析带来极大便利。选择适合的引用方式,可有效提升数据管理与分析效率,使 Excel 成为轻量级的数据集成平台。
《excel中如何引用前表格数据库》
一、EXCEL中前表格数据库的常见引用方式
在日常工作中,Excel 用户经常需要在一个工作簿中调用另一个“前表格”或上游数据区域,将其视作简易数据库来进行分析和处理。下面是最常用的几种方法:
| 方法 | 适用场景 | 优点 | 劣势 |
|---|---|---|---|
| 直接单元格引用 | 小规模简单调用 | 快速直观 | 易出错、不便维护 |
| 命名范围 | 多次重复使用 | 易读性好,便于管理 | 手动维护复杂时麻烦 |
| Power Query | 大量、多源数据整合 | 动态、强大、自动更新 | 初学者需学习 |
| VLOOKUP/INDEX+MATCH | 按条件查找关联记录 | 灵活检索 | 数据增减需调整区域 |
- 直接单元格/区域引用:
- 示例:=Sheet1!A1:B10
- 优点:新手易学,适合少量数据。
- 命名范围:
- 示例:在公式栏输入=销售额,并将Sheet1!A1:B10命名为“销售额”
- 优点:跨表可读性强。
- Power Query(强烈推荐):
- 步骤:插入 → 获取和转换 → 从工作簿/文件导入
- 优点:支持外部源、多表逻辑转换。
- VLOOKUP/INDEX+MATCH查找法:
- 示例:=VLOOKUP(“关键字”, Sheet1!A:B,2,FALSE)
- 优点:实现类“数据库查询”效果。
二、POWER QUERY 高效实现表间数据集成
Power Query 是 Excel 内置的数据连接与转换工具,可以轻松把“前一个表”的内容当作数据库源动态调用。其典型操作流程如下:
- 打开目标工作簿,点击【数据】→【获取和转换】→【从其他工作簿】;
- 浏览并选中需要引用的 Excel 文件或当前文件中的其他工作表;
- 在弹出的编辑器窗口,可对原始区域进行筛选、排序、字段拆分等操作;
- 点击【关闭并加载】,将处理后的结果输出至新工作表;
- 每当原始“前表”内容变更时,只需刷新即可同步更新引用结果。
优势说明:
- 支持多文件、多格式(如 CSV、Access 等)导入;
- 自动检测结构变化,无需手工调整公式范围;
- 可保存复杂的数据清洗与转换规则,一键复用。
应用场景举例: 假设企业每月汇总不同门店的销售明细,需要定期从多个 Excel 表汇总到总报表,只需设置一次 Power Query,每月刷新即可自动完成,无需反复复制粘贴,大幅提升效率并降低错误率。
三、多种函数法实现灵活查询与统计
除了 Power Query 外,Excel 的经典函数也能满足部分类似“数据库查询”的需求。以下为常见函数及适用说明:
| 函数名称 | 用法示例 | 特点 |
|---|---|---|
| VLOOKUP | =VLOOKUP(查找值, 前表区域, 返回列号, 精确/模糊) | 一维纵向查找,多用于主键精确匹配 |
| INDEX+MATCH | =INDEX(返回列, MATCH(查找值, 查找列,0)) | 灵活度高,可横向纵向混合检索 |
| SUMIF/SUMIFS | =SUMIF(条件列, 条件, 求和列) | 实现分组求和统计,如按部门统计销售额 |
| FILTER | =FILTER(区域, 条件表达式) (Office365新特性) |
函数应用注意事项:
- 区域要绝对定位(如$A$1:$B$100),避免拖拽公式时错位;
- 若前后结构变化(如新增列),函数参数需随之调整,否则可能出错;
- 对大批量数据运算速度有限,不适用于超大型或频繁变更的数据集成场景。
实例说明: 某公司有两张工作表,“员工信息”和“工资发放”。需要按工号把工资发放金额补充到员工信息页,可用 VLOOKUP 或 INDEX+MATCH 查找匹配并填充,实现类似数据库关联查询功能。
四、“命名范围”与结构化引用方法详解
命名范围是指给某一块连续单元格赋予易记名字,使其像变量一样被调用。这对于多人协作、大型项目尤为有益,有利于提高公式可维护性及文档规范性。
操作步骤:
- 用鼠标选中目标单元格区域,比如 Sheet1!A1:C100;
- 在左上角名称框输入自定义名称(如DataTable),回车确定;
- 在其他任何地方输入=DataTable,即可快速获取该块内容;
高级技巧:
- 命名范围可以跨多个 sheet 使用,也支持动态扩展,如利用 OFFSET 函数搭建自增长区间。
- 多个不同区域分别命名后,可通过下拉菜单快速选择插入,提高效率。
优缺点分析:
| 优点 | 缺点 |
|---|---|
| 提升可读性 | 区域变动时需手动修改 |
| 管理方便 | 不支持复杂关系建模 |
综合建议:“命名范围”适用于稳定结构的数据调用,而对于经常增删行或多层级关联推荐采用 Power Query 或 SQL 查询工具。
五、EXCEL高级技巧——结合外部数据库及API集成方案
Excel 不仅能内部跨 sheet 引用,更可以通过 ODBC/OLEDB 等方式连接 Access/MySQL/SQL Server 等专业型数据库,实现真正意义上的企业级前后端分离式管理。此外,新版 Excel 支持 REST API 数据源接入,为云端协同办公提供无限可能。例如:
- 利用【数据】-【获取外部数据】-【自 Access/MYSQL】导入业务系统实时库;
- 借助 VBA 宏自动抓取 Web API 返回的 JSON/XML 数据流,再解析至本地报表;
- 对接简道云零代码开发平台等第三方 SaaS 系统,将企业在线业务流转结果直接嵌入 Excel 分析模型,实现真正无缝融合。
实际案例分享: 某大型连锁零售集团,通过 ODBC 挂载总部 ERP 系统 MySQL 库,每天定时同步商品库存到财务部门专属报表,实现了库存预警与财务核算一体化,大幅减少人工整理环节,提高决策效率。
六、“简道云零代码开发平台”助力企业智能化升级(含官网链接)
面对传统 Excel 管理局限,越来越多企业选择借助低代码乃至零代码平台,如简道云零代码开发平台 ,快速搭建专属业务系统并与 Office 办公环境无缝融合。其主要优势如下:
- 无需编程基础,通过拖拽式界面配置流程和报表,自定义字段即刻上线应用;
- 支持多端协同——PC/移动端随时随地访问填写审核任务,大大提升团队响应速度与透明度;
- 与第三方服务深度衔接,如钉钉企业微信消息推送、一键导出到 Excel/PDF,多维度支撑经营决策;
- 内置丰富模板市场&组件库,上百种行业场景即装即用,省去重复搭建成本;
典型应用效果: 比如 HR 部门基于简道云搭建员工档案&绩效考核小程序,再通过平台接口自动汇总考核结论到总部财务月度绩效奖金模型,由此彻底打通人事—财务—业务三条线,实现全流程数字化闭环,无缝对接传统 Excel 报告体系,让管理更智能、更高效!
七、小结与实操建议
综上所述,在 Excel 中高效安全地引用前置“数据库”或上游主控明细,有多种成熟方案可供选择。从简单的单元格链接,到强大的 Power Query 动态同步,再到低代码平台联动,都能满足不同规模下的数据整合需求。其中建议:
- 日常小型项目优先尝试命名单元格+基本函数组合,
- 遇到频繁变更或批量整合任务应优先学习掌握 Power Query,
- 若希望拓展更高阶协作能力,则考虑结合简道云零代码开发平台等在线系统共同推进数字化升级;
最终目标,是让每位用户都能最大限度发挥 Excel 的灵活性,同时享受现代企业级信息化工具带来的便捷高效!
100+企业管理系统模板免费使用>>>无需下载,在线安装: https://s.fanruan.com/l0cac
精品问答:
文章版权归"
转载请注明出处:https://www.jiandaoyun.com/nblog/86898/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com
删除。